(Whitewater Township, Oh.) - It happened again Wednesday. A semi truck overturned on the ramp from northbound Interstate 275 to westbound Interstate 74 in Whitewater Township.
The accident happened at about 10:45 a.m. when a truck carrying plastic bottle caps overturned on the looping right-hand turn.
The driver, who has not been identified, suffered some minor injuries.
The ramp reopened at about 2:20 p.m. Ohio Department of Transportation officials said towing crews on the scene were using large air bags to try and place the truck back upright, a process that can take two to four hours. The reopening takes longer if the semi has to be unloaded first.
Semi trucks fall victim by not heeding the 25 MPH warning sign at the large, 270 degree right turn.
